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[jsk_tools] Add node to publish diagnostics based on topic and node status #4

Merged
merged 15 commits into from
May 23, 2022

Conversation

708yamaguchi
Copy link
Collaborator

Duplicate of jsk-ros-pkg#1727

I want robots to talk about the status of diagnostics using jsk-ros-pkg#1607.

@708yamaguchi 708yamaguchi changed the title [jsk_tools] Return value of checkNodeState [jsk_tools] Add node to publish diagnostics based on topic and node status May 12, 2022
@708yamaguchi
Copy link
Collaborator Author

@iory

Could you review this?

@708yamaguchi
Copy link
Collaborator Author

@knorth55

Could you merge this or give me merge permission?
jsk-ros-pkg PR is merged.

@708yamaguchi 708yamaguchi force-pushed the sanity-diagnostics-fetch15 branch from 0af6e3a to 3edfa96 Compare May 22, 2022 22:59
@708yamaguchi
Copy link
Collaborator Author

@iory

#6sample_audible_warning.launchを実行すると、エラーとstaleが出ます

エラーの原因は確認できていないのですが、少なくともstaleの方は、このプルリクエストで使っているdiagnostics_analyzer.yaml#6 でも使われているからだと思います。

矢野倉さん的には、同じdiagnostics_analyzer.yamlを使いまわすのがよいと考えていますか?

audible

@708yamaguchi
Copy link
Collaborator Author

あと個人的TODOですが、PR1040体内のjsk_toolsがpr1040-with-audible-warningブランチのままになっているので、このプルリクエストに相当するプルリクエストをpr1040ブランチ?に出さないといけないです

@iory
Copy link
Collaborator

iory commented May 23, 2022

矢野倉さん的には、同じdiagnostics_analyzer.yamlを使いまわすのがよいと考えていますか?

これは意図的に同じにしていたのですが、staleが出ていると紛らわしいということなので、分割しました。
jsk-ros-pkg@7b4e673

@708yamaguchi
Copy link
Collaborator Author

708yamaguchi commented May 23, 2022

ご対応ありがとうございました。
cherry-pickしました。

@knorth55
fetch実機でも試していて問題なさそうなのですが、マージしていただけますか?
あと、PR2用ブランチにもプルリクエストを送りたいのですが、pr1040ブランチってありますか?

@knorth55 knorth55 merged commit 4651c4a into knorth55:fetch15 May 23, 2022
@knorth55 knorth55 mentioned this pull request May 23, 2022
@knorth55
Copy link
Owner

@708yamaguchi #7 これでいいかな

@708yamaguchi
Copy link
Collaborator Author

@knorth55

わざわざすみません,ありがとうございます.
助かりました.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ants